Hello:

Just a routine UOA for our 2011 BMW E90 328i, N51.

12/10/2014 sample = German Castrol 0W-30, 4147 miles on oil
04/10/2016 sample = Liqui-Moly Leichlauf 5W-40, 128 miles on oil
09/20/2019 sample = BMW TPT 5W-30, 4913 miles on oil

Hengst oil and air filters. It is my belief the BMW TPT is Shell/Pennzoil GTL.

Mostly warm to hot summer temperature highways miles. Easy duty for both engine and oil, but the motor seems to like the TPT oil.

For an explanation of why I had only a 128 mile OCI for the Liqui-Moly oil, see my earlier thread. I reposted the original VOA and UOA results on 09/27/2019 (page 3).

It is SHell oil, but that TPT has NOACK 6.2%. I would say it is more stout package and better base oil than what Pennzoil offers in stores.
